高優先級調度算法: 算法思想 按照優先級(等待時間 + 要求服務時間) / 要求服務時間進行排序,總是運行優先級最高的進程不可搶占,只有當前進程運行完了才考慮其他進程的運行。 優缺點 綜合考慮了等待時間換運行時間(要求時間),等待時間相同時,要求服務時間短的優先(SJF的優點);要求服務 ...
public class Process private String name 進程名字 private int priority 進程優先級,默認為 , lt pri lt public Process String name super this.name name priority System.out.println System.out.println this.getName 已經生 ...
2016-12-26 10:20 0 3181 推薦指數:
高優先級調度算法: 算法思想 按照優先級(等待時間 + 要求服務時間) / 要求服務時間進行排序,總是運行優先級最高的進程不可搶占,只有當前進程運行完了才考慮其他進程的運行。 優缺點 綜合考慮了等待時間換運行時間(要求時間),等待時間相同時,要求服務時間短的優先(SJF的優點);要求服務 ...
1. 算法性質 HRRN算法既考慮了作業的等待時間,又考慮作業的運行時間,因此既照顧了短作業,又不致使長作業的等待時間過長,從而改善了處理機調度的性能。 2. 實現方法 我們為每個作業引入一個動態優先級,即優先級會隨着時間的增加而動態增加,這樣使得長作業的優先級在等待期間不斷地增加 ...
FIFO:先進先出調度算法LRU:最近最久未使用調度算法兩者都是緩存調度算法,經常用作內存的頁面置換算法。打一個比方,幫助你理解。你有很多的書,比如說10000本。由於你的書實在太多了,你只能放在地下室里面。你看書的時候不會在地下室看書,而是在書房看書。每次,你想看書都必須跑到地下室去找出來你想 ...
模擬頁式虛擬存儲管理中硬件的地址轉換和用先進先出調度算法處理缺頁中斷 實驗內容與步驟↓↓↓ 編寫程序,模擬頁式虛擬存儲管理中硬件的地址轉換和用先進先出調度算法處理缺頁中斷。 假定主存的每塊長度為1024個字節,現有一個共7頁的作業,其副本已在磁盤上。系統為該作業分配了4個主存塊 ...
#include "stdio.h" #include <stdlib.h> #include <conio.h> #include<windows.h> #def ...
/*非搶占式優先級調度算法*/ #include <iostream> using namespace std; struct Num { int priority; //優先級 int dt; //到達時間 int st; //運行時間 }sum ...
處理機調度算法:Priority scheduling algorithm 優先級調度算法(搶占式) 運行結果 流程圖 ---------------------java代碼------------------------ ...
處理機調度算法:Priority scheduling algorithm 優先級調度算法 運行結果 流程圖 ---------------------java代碼------------------------ ...